Добро пожаловать в форум, Guest  >>   Войти | Регистрация | Поиск | Правила | В избранное | Подписаться
Все форумы / Microsoft Access Новый топик    Ответить
 Как указать поля таблицы из VBA?  [new]
toly_m
Guest
Привет всем!

Есть tblTable, где 20 полей: D1, D2, ..., D20.
Нужно в VBA их прокрутить, например так:
    bytI =0
    Set rst = CurrentDb.OpenRecordset("tblTable")
    With rst
          While bytI < 21
              bytI = bytI + 1
              MsgBox !["D" & bytI]
          Wend
    End With

В строке MsgBox !["D" & bytI] дает ошибку 3265 - Элемент не обнаружен в данном семействе. Пробовал ![("D" & bytI)], !D & bytI и другие - не вышло. Подскажите, плз!
24 авг 04, 07:51    [902667]     Ответить | Цитировать Сообщить модератору
 Re: Как указать поля таблицы из VBA?  [new]
aleks2
Guest
MsgBox .Fields("D" & bytI)
24 авг 04, 07:53    [902668]     Ответить | Цитировать Сообщить модератору
 Re: Как указать поля таблицы из VBA?  [new]
toly_m
Guest
aleks2


Спасиб!
24 авг 04, 09:08    [902742]     Ответить | Цитировать Сообщить модератору
 Re: Как указать поля таблицы из VBA?  [new]
Лох Позорный
Member

Откуда:
Сообщений: 9898
https://www.sql.ru/forum/actualthread.aspx?bid=4&tid=115626
24 авг 04, 09:16    [902756]     Ответить | Цитировать Сообщить модератору
Все форумы / Microsoft Access Ответить